BBC Wiltshire's Chris Wise at Swindon Town's County Ground: "Bradley Wright-Phillips is due to arrive in Swindon at 2000 GMT to discuss a possible loan move from Charlton. Team-mate Danny Green is also set to sign until the end of the season, along with Cheltenham midfielder Marlon Pack."

Sending BWP on loan would be a strange one as it means we're writing him off as a saleable asset. I think 6 months would do Greeny the world of good and he may come back full of confidence. Sometimes I wonder what might have been with him if he hadn't had that suspension at the start of last season. He looked like he was ready to take on the world in pre-season. Still, I'm hardly looking back ashamed of our work last year. With BWP though his contract is up come June so we're basically saying we can't sell him and we'd rather have him off the wage bill than keep him around, which is odd. Unless of course we have a decent replacement lined up, which as we're Charlton, we don't.
All of that assumes that this deal is actually on of course..0 -
